Adele has opened up about her decision to cancel her Las Vegas residency performances at the last minute.The Make You Feel My Love star, 33, admitted she has regrets over pulling the plug on the performances, which were due to take place at Caesars Palace, at the eleventh hour.

Brit Award winning star Adele, who recently surprised fans as she pole danced at a nightclub, said she "wasn't ready" as she opened up on the Graham Norton Show.

She explained for the first time since releasing a video to cancel the performances: "I tried my hardest and really thought I would be able to pull something else together in time and that was why it was so last minute, which I regret that I kept going until that late in the day. "It just wasn't ready and there were lots of reasons why; there were Covid delays with pieces of the show – there were some things that weren't going to be arriving until the day of the show, so therefore I'd never be able to see them or approve them, here were lots of delays for that.
